What is a Liquid CO2 Storage Tank?

A Liquid CO2 storage tank is specifically designed to store carbon dioxide in its liquid state. This state is achieved by applying pressure and lowering the temperature of the gas. These tanks are commonly utilized in sectors requiring carbon dioxide for various applications, such as carbonation in beverages or as a refrigerant.

How Liquid CO2 Storage Tanks Work

Liquid CO2 is stored under high pressure, often between 800 to 1,200 psi. The high pressure keeps it in a liquid state, preventing it from evaporating into a gas. When released from the tank, it can be used immediately as a gas for various processes. Many tanks are equipped with safety features to regulate pressure and ensure the safe handling of CO2.

Key Considerations for Liquid CO2 Storage Tanks

  1. Safety Protocols: Due to the high pressures involved, safety measures must be in place. Regular inspections, maintenance schedules, and staff training are essential to mitigate risks.

  2. Installation and Compliance: Always ensure that your storage tanks comply with local regulations and industry standards. Proper installation follows guidelines that enhance the efficiency and safety of the tanks.

  3. Tank Sizing: Determine the appropriate tank size for your needs. This decision should take into account your production levels and space availability.

  4. Monitoring and Maintenance: Regular monitoring of tank pressure and levels is crucial. Maintaining the structural integrity of the tank can prevent costly issues down the line.

Best Practices for Managing Liquid CO2 Storage

  • Regular Inspections: Schedule routine checks to assess the tank's condition and detect potential leaks before they become serious issues.

  • Proper Training: Ensure that all personnel who interact with liquid CO2 storage are trained in safety protocols and tank operation.

  • Emergency Protocols: Have a clear emergency response plan in place. This plan should include procedures for dealing with leaks or accidents involving liquid CO2.
